Read the following passage from the Biology Department at University of California, Berkeley.

Northern elephant seals have reduced genetic variation because hunting by humans reduced their population size to as few as 20 individuals at the end of the 19th century. Their population has since rebounded to over 30,000, but their genes still carry the marks of this near extinction: they have much less genetic variation than a population of southern elephant seals that was not hunted as intensely.

This assignment is designed to deepen one’s understanding of the proliferation of function creep and data exhaust – two concepts that are important to understand in today’s data-rich environment. Function creep refers to data collected for one purpose and then used for another, unintended purpose. Data exhaust is the term used to describe all the data we produce while going about our daily lives. The activity is simple and scalable just follow these rules:

Irritant or allergic occupational dermatitis can be caused by chemicals used at work that constantly in contact with our skin. Many substances can penetrate the skin and are capable of causing diseases elsewhere in the body. While harmful substances and wet work are a major cause of skin disease, constantly working in uncomfortably hot or cold surroundings or excessively dry or wet conditions can also cause serious skin disorders. The stipulation of protective gear like gloves and its proper usage and safe working distance are essential to reduce, if not eliminate dermatitis in the workplace.
